Formatting HTML

Consider this code:

HtmlMeta meta = new HtmlMeta();
meta.Attributes.Add("description", "whatever, whatever, whatever");

HtmlHead head = (HtmlHead)Page.Header;
head.Controls.Add(meta );

That code writes a meta tag into the head element but it appends the meta
tag declaration to the end of other text located between the head elements.
How do we format the output of the meta tag text so it will begin on a new
line?

// what occurs
<link ... /><meta ... />

// what is desired
<link ... />
<meta... />
<meta... />
